Researchers from the University of Virginia have made significant strides in the rapidly advancing field of 3D-printed concrete by developing a more sustainable, printable cementitious composite. This new material, which combines graphene with limestone and calcined clay cement (LC2), offers enhanced strength and durability while significantly reducing carbon emissions, making it a powerful solution for addressing the environmental challenges in 3D printed construction.

With the first wave of the energy transition, renewable energy sources (such as solar and wind) have begun replacing coal power generation. However, some sectors are lagging behind and struggling to decarbonize more than others, including large-scale transportation like commercial aviation, shipping, and rail transit. Electrofuels (aka eFuels) are the next generation of solutions to help the hardest-to-abate sectors pivot from their reliance on fossil fuels.
